win32 F/OSS development - Perl
Perl is a procedural scripting language used for text processing and CGI scripts. It's one of the 'P's in LAMP and is the scripting language of choice when bash won't do...
Install
There are two main binary Perl ports for win32; ActivePerl and PxPerl.
Alternatly, you can build from source if you've got MinGW installed with dmake in your path.
Head over to Active State and grab the latest installer.
Click the 'Get ActivePerl' link under the lizard, then the 'Free Download' link.
Finally click continue when asked for contact details.
Since it's a windows installer, just double click the executable when downloaded.
